Laserjet pro MFP M426fdw

M426fdw requires master reset; I have followed the instructions:  restart printer while holding lower right corner of the touch screen.  doesn't work.

I have tried call a couple of HP support numbers and it was simply a waste of time, and no support on Sat...

 

Any help is appreciated.

4 REPLIES 4
HP Recommended

solved.   unplugged and powered on while holding to the right of the ?

HP Recommended

Thank you! This finally worked.

 

 I held down both the lower left and lower right corners of the touchscreen, with two fingers, as hard as I  could, while I powered it on. 

 

 I did try pressing to the right of the ? like you said. It didn't work, but I may have missed the sweet spot that time. Other places had said to hold down the bottom right corner of the touchscreen, instead of the left, and I'd tried that several times.

 

This LaserJet Pro MFP M426fdw was driving me nuts because we'd lost the password and could not do a factory reset through the setup menu.
